Collaborate Visually With Mindjet

They say that two heads are better than one — and when it comes to competing in today’s media markets, the power of collaborative thought cannot be overemphasized — although the logistics of working with an often geographically dispersed brain trust is something that requires automation to optimize. Likewise, even when working alone, keeping track of your thoughts and plans can become a full-time occupation.

Enter Mindjet (www.mindjet.com), a tool for visually connecting ideas, information and people. According to the company, Mindjet provides personal productivity and collaboration solutions that save time, improve business processes and drive innovation.

“Used by more than 1.5 million professionals around the world in six out of every 10 of the companies listed in the Fortune 100, Mindjet solutions dramatically boost productivity and team effectiveness,” states the company website. “Surveys across several industries show that Mindjet can increase productivity by up to 25 percent by making meetings, common communications and project management tasks more efficient and effective.”

Through the power of mind mapping, Mindjet combines a visual productivity application with a comprehensive collaboration platform, which includes document and file sharing, secure workspaces and web conferencing, to efficiently organize complex ideas and processes — increasing clarity and turning ideas into action.

“So whether you are driving the sales process, managing a project, building a strategic plan, running a brainstorming session, conducting a meeting, or simply getting organized, Mindjet helps you succeed with almost any business or personal productivity challenge,” its website adds. “People can work individually or collaborate in real-time to organize, manage and communicate ideas and information while solving real business problems.
